Puppy Love—Nutcracker Edition

You already know dancers really love their dogs. But Sacramento Ballet is taking their animal affection a whole new level. They’ve partnered with Sacramento’s Front Street Animal Shelter to feature adorable, furry friends in their annual production of The Nutcracker.
